Original artwork description:

With Drift and Flow, I wanted to paint an abstraction, the way the coast feels, constantly shifting, never still. The deep blues pull like the tide, while warm ochres and soft neutrals hint at sunlit sand and weathered cliffs. The palette knife gave the texture I was after, rough in places, smooth in others, just like the landscape itself.
